A lot of it depends upon the components themselves. In your case, depending upon the component, the items you are looking for may not actually be child objects but properties of the status bar itself. I know there are components that I work with that are perceived in that way.
If you can post a screenshot of the properties of the status bar you are working with, we might be able to help you identify what you are looking for.

Sorry, what we are looking for are the properties from Object Spy! Point to your object and use Advanced and then take a screenshot of that and post it.
What is likely is that there is an Index field or something similar that has your embedded objects in it. That's what tristaanogre meant when he said there might not be child objects.
If you post the screenshot of the Object Spy details, we can help you guess at the fields you need to reference those objects.
